HUTCHINSON, Kan. – The Golf Coaches Association of America announced Friday the five finalists for the Jack Nicklaus Award, a group headlined by newly crowned Ben Hogan Award winner Patrick Rodgers.

Rodgers, a six-time winner this season, is the favorite for college’s Player of the Year award.

Other finalists include Georgia Tech’s Ollie Schniederjans, whose five wins this season are a school record; Alabama’s Robby Shelton and Bobby Wyatt; and Stanford’s Cameron Wilson.

The winner will be recognized June 1 during the final round of the Memorial.
